In the evening of January 16th, a white wagtail spread her wings stumbled over a brackish water pond in Long Valley.  He became aware of a mate flew in her oscillating path except in opposite phase.  Trying to greet her mate, she put down her feet raised her head boosted her breast and flapped her pair of wings horizontally.  Finally she landed on the water surface only to find her own reflection.
